Jeff Van Gundy: Knicks a 50-win team unless Derrick Rose nukes it
By Jonathan Lehman September 23, 2016 | 12:27pm

The Knicks have had just one 50-game winner since Jeff Van Gundy roamed their sideline.
But the former coach-turned-ESPN analyst thinks this season?s dramatically revamped Knicks roster has a good chance to hit that formidable benchmark.
?I think they?re going to be 45 to 50 [wins], low 50s, in that range,? Van Gundy said this week on Stashed Media?s ?33rd and 7th? podcast with Anthony Donahue.
?I certainly believe their starting lineup has the potential to be a 50-game winner, without question.?
Van Gundy ticked off what he called the sure things in that starting lineup: Carmelo Anthony, free-agent additions Joakim Noah and Courtney Lee, and sophomore phenom Kristaps Porzingis, who Van Gundy said is ?set up to be an absolute star.?
What worries him is the bench and the bust potential with point guard Derrick Rose, the former MVP acquired in a blockbuster offseason trade with the Bulls. Rose, who turns 28 in early October, has had a litany of problems with his knees. More troubling, he is the defendant in a civil case, set to go to trial on Oct. 4 in Los Angeles, in which an ex-girlfriend alleges Rose and two friends gang-raped her while she was incapacitated after a night of drinking in 2013. The lawsuit seeks $21.5 million.
?Rose, to me, is the wild card,? Van Gundy said. ?I have no idea what to expect of Rose: health standpoint, game standpoint, fit standpoint and then legal standpoint, how that impacts him. To me, they have a lot of known quantities. The big unknown is Rose.?

Still, Van Gundy concluded he expects Rose to play better than he did last season ? ?and I thought he was pretty good last year.? In 66 games in 2015-16, Rose averaged 16.4 points on 42.7 percent shooting and 4.7 assists.
Van Gundy, who last coached with the Rockets in 2007 and was in the mix for a number of openings (including Houston and Minnesota) this summer, was most effusive in his praise for Porzingis and his ?massive potential.?
?His versatility showed how good he can be and I just loved how he took accountability for his play [last season], good and bad, how he was as a teammate,? Van Gundy said. ?I just love his whole approach, to getting better, to accepting of coaching.?
Jeff Hornacek ? JVG?s review: ?I like his demeanor. I like the fit for New York? ? is the new coach, tasked by Phil Jackson with elevating a brand-new mix of talent back to instant playoff contention.
?Certainly the Knicks are a more interesting team today than they were at any point last year,? Van Gundy said. ?That does not mean necessarily that they?re a better team. I think they will be better. I think they are a playoff team.?
